Qué cubre este documento
- Encabezado del WH-347: proyecto, número de contrato, determinación salarial, número de nómina y fin de semana
- Cada trabajador con solo los últimos cuatro dígitos del SSN — nunca el número completo
- Horas de cada día de domingo a sábado, separadas en tiempo normal y horas extra, con totales automáticos
- Tarifas, crédito de beneficios y beneficios en efectivo, bruto del proyecto y de todo el trabajo, deducciones y neto
- Declaración de Cumplimiento de la página 2 con las seis certificaciones y la advertencia de declaración falsa
Cómo usar este Nómina Certificada (Formulario WH-347) en US
Complete primero el encabezado: nombre y ubicación del proyecto, número de contrato, la determinación salarial de la que salen las tarifas, el número de nómina (comience en 1 y continúe consecutivamente) y la fecha de fin de semana. Marque si presenta como contratista principal o subcontratista, y si es la nómina final del proyecto.
Luego cada trabajador: nombre, el número identificador —solo los últimos cuatro dígitos del SSN—, la clasificación exacta de la determinación salarial y las horas de domingo a sábado separadas en tiempo normal y horas extra. Ingrese la tarifa por hora, el crédito de beneficios a planes o fondos y los beneficios pagados en efectivo. El bruto del proyecto se calcula solo; el bruto de todo el trabajo se ingresa cuando el trabajador también trabajó en otra obra esa semana. Las deducciones se detallan y el neto es lo que el trabajador recibió.
La página 2 es la Declaración de Cumplimiento y es lo que convierte la nómina en 'certificada'. Las certificaciones 1, 2, 3 y 6 siempre se hacen; la 4 cubre aprendices registrados ante la OA o una SAA; la 5 cubre beneficios pagados a planes aprobados o en efectivo. Firma el contratista, el subcontratista o quien supervisa el pago de salarios (29 C.F.R. § 3.3(b)); la falsificación intencional conlleva enjuiciamiento (18 U.S.C. § 1001; 31 U.S.C. § 3729) e inhabilitación.
